Motorcycling-Darryn Binder steps up to MotoGP with RNF Racing


FILE PHOTO: MotoGP - Catalunya Grand Prix -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ya, Barcelona, Spain - September 27, 2020. CIP Green Power's Darryn Binder celebrates with sparkling wine on the podium after winning the Moto3 race. REUTERS/Albert Gea

(Reuters) - South African Darryn Binder, younger brother of KTM MotoGP rider Brad, will enter the top category next season with the independent RNF Racing team using Yamaha bikes.

Binder, 23, is currently competing in the Moto3 category with the Petronas Sprinta team and joins on a one-year contract with an option for 2023.
